Product Description

The BirdDog P4K is a remarkable PTZ camera. It features a large 1” Sony Exmor R CMOS back-lit sensor with 14.4 million effective pixels, delivering stunning 4K pictures via Full Bandwidth NDI. Its excellent light sensitivity makes it ideal for various broadcast scenarios, including sports, remote studios, newsrooms, and worship places. The 1” Sony sensor ensures top - notch image quality in all shooting modes and frame rates. As a Full NDI camera, it offers uncompromised performance. It's not just for live production; you can use it to shoot in true cinematic styles. With advanced color controls, superfine robotics, 360 - degree tally lights, and multiple connection options like Full NDI, 6G SDI, and HDMI 2.0, it provides amazing flexibility. Genlock allows you to synchronize multiple cameras easily. Technical specifications include a 1.0 - type back - illuminated Exmor R CMOS sensor, 14.2 Megapixels of effective pixels, and more.

Using the BirdDog P4K is straightforward. First, choose the right mount for your shooting needs, like ceiling, wall, or tripod. Connect it to your power source, either with 12VDC or PoE++. Then, connect it to your video and audio equipment using the available ports such as NDI, HDMI, or 6G - SDI for video, and 3.5mm jacks for audio. When shooting, you can adjust settings like focus, white balance, and exposure according to the lighting conditions. You can also use presets to quickly set up your shot. For maintenance, keep the camera in a clean and dry environment. Avoid exposing it to extreme temperatures and humidity. Clean the lens regularly with a soft cloth. When not in use, turn it off properly. Make sure to update the firmware regularly to get the best performance and new features. And always be careful when handling the camera to avoid any physical damage.
